Job Duties

  • Patrol designated rail yards, facilities, and surrounding property along assigned routes using a company vehicle
  • conduct perimeter checks and monitor access points to prevent unauthorized entry or trespassing
  • inspect fences, gates, railcars, and buildings for signs of tampering, damage, or suspicious activity
  • deter theft, vandalism, and other criminal activity through a visible security presence
  • respond promptly to alarms, incidents, and emergencies
  • coordinate with law enforcement or emergency services as needed
  • write detailed incident and activity reports, logging observations and actions taken during shifts
  • ensure compliance with client safety protocols, security policies, and federal regulations
  • monitor and report hazardous conditions that may impact rail operations or employee safety
  • perform vehicle inspections before and after use of the company vehicle
